What is tally-mcp-server?

This is a Tally Prime MCP (Model Context Protocol) server implementation.

How to use tally-mcp-server?

The server is designed to feed Tally ERP data to LLMs that support the MCP protocol.

Key features of tally-mcp-server

  • Tally Prime MCP implementation

  • Support for LLMs like Claude and ChatGPT

  • Enables data transfer from Tally ERP to LLMs

  • Facilitates integration between Tally and AI models

Use cases of tally-mcp-server

  • Analyzing Tally data using LLMs

  • Generating reports from Tally data using AI

  • Automating tasks in Tally using LLMs

  • Integrating Tally data with other AI-powered applications
